Stellantis Makes Strides Toward an All-Electric Fleet

On its mission to be the greenest SUV brand on earth, Stellantis is gaining ground and building its portfolio of premium hybrid vehicles.

The first minivan to offer both gas and electric powertrains, the Chrysler Pacifica Hybrid offers Best in Class Fuel Economy with 2.7 Le/100 km or 105 MPGe in city driving. It takes you places with an all-electric range of 51 km and a total combined driving range of 835 km.

The Jeep Wrangler 4xe Plug-In Hybrid is a product of progressive electric innovation. Powered by an acclaimed 4x4 system, its outstanding capability is matched with eco-friendly technology. The most 4x4-capable and sustainable All-New Grand Cherokee 4xe offers unmatched design and driving dynamics. Equipped with a 2.0L Turbo Plug-In Hybrid Electric Vehicle (PHEV) engine and a 17kWh lithium-ion battery pack, it delivers an all-electric range of up to 42 km and a total range of up to 761 km.

Jeep has been synonymous with freedom and adventure for over 80 years. On its path to accomplishing Zero Emission Freedom, the iconic brand has recently announced its first-ever fully electric SUV set for launch early next year. As part of this global electrification mandate, all Jeep brand SUVs will offer an electrified variant by 2025.

Stellantis is ushering in a new era of innovative technology, advanced 4x4 capability, and electrification for those that seek extraordinary journeys and near-complete silence.
